Computational Designer (AEC Industries)

Slate Technologies
5dRemote

About The Position

Join Slate as a Computational Designer and Software Developer, where you’ll be at the forefront of creating innovative, real-world solutions in Architecture, Engineering, and Construction. Collaborate with a global team of designers, developers, engineers, and industry experts to develop cloud-based computational solutions using Grasshopper and Rhino Compute. As a vital member of our computational design team, you will: Collaborate with teammates to build modular, scalable solutions Utilize your creativity and expertise in visual scripting to deliver high-quality outputs Adhere to pre-existing guidelines while seizing opportunities to enhance and grow our platform If you have a vision and passion for deploying computational design solutions to users of varying skill levels, we’d love to hear from you!

Requirements

  • A minimum of 8+ years of experience using Rhino and Grasshopper to develop custom software solutions for industry.
  • Experience in AEC Industries: Understanding or experience working in Architecture, Engineering, and Construction
  • Self-Motivated Learner: A fast-paced, self-learning individual who thrives in dynamic environments
  • Team-Oriented: Willingness to develop and learn alongside a pre-existing team and solutions
  • Collaborative: A highly collaborative team player who excels in cooperative settings
  • Organized and Responsive: Highly organized with a strong sense of responsiveness
  • Detail-Oriented: Attention to detail and commitment to quality
  • Strong Communication Skills: Excellent verbal, written, and graphic communication skills
  • Industry Advocate: Acts as a champion for computational design and industry excellence
  • Proficient in Computational Design using Grasshopper
  • Expertise in Generative Design and Parametric Modeling
  • Ability to create Complex Geometry
  • Skills in Rendering and Visualizations.
  • Strong understanding of Data Structures and Manipulations
  • Python expertise
  • C# expertise, particularly with Rhino Compute
  • Familiarity with the Grasshopper SDK
  • Experience with Visual Studio Code or similar development environments
  • A portfolio showcasing contributions to the physical world through computational design

Nice To Haves

  • Experience with Artificial Intelligence and Machine Learning
  • Expertise in Rhino, Inside, Revit, Dynamo, Figma, Revit, AutoCAD, Inventor, Fusion, and/or other AEC industry tools
  • Knowledge of three.js and/or ReactJS
  • Experience in Digital Fabrication/Manufacturing
  • Experience in Design for Manufacturing and Assembly
  • Passion for developing robust software and writing maintainable code
  • Proven ability to work in a fast paced, highly responsive agile team with rapidly evolving requirements and architectures
  • Experience and knowledge with BIM (E.g., Revit and IFC)
  • Excellent verbal and written communication skills

Responsibilities

  • Work within the existing framework of Slate’s Generate platform for computational design, while exploring potential enhancements
  • Consistently deliver high-quality Grasshopper solutions that are organized and tailored to client-specific outputs
  • Develop custom API solutions for interoperability between multiple software platforms (e.g., Revit, AutoCAD, Excel, Word, and more)
  • Create custom nodes in Python and C#, transforming them into custom plugins, hops, etc.
  • Handle client data that may be sensitive or confidential with utmost care
  • Collaborate directly with leaders of the computational design and engineering teams to assist in executing full-stack software solutions
  • Push the boundaries of what’s possible with your creativity and unique perspectives

Benefits

  • At Slate, we invest in our employees and provide a full range of benefits and perks to help you grow and thrive.
  • From generous paid time off and healthcare coverage to career enrichment and development strategies.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service